Stop Aging, Start Training by Salvatore Fichera Pdf

In this book, author Sal Fichera draws on his impressive resume as a certified personal trainer and professional public lecturer to write authoritatively and effectively about fitness, health, and mind/body synergy. Fichera's focus is on creating a fully rounded approach to solutions for health and appearance. He is dedicated to helping clients and audiences improve quality of, life, reverse the biological clock, and become just plain healthier, leaner, and stronger. Stop Aging-Start Training is for anyone who has begun to notice his or her body is aging, and is interested in living a longer, stronger, happier life. It utilizes the three most important components of exercise-variety, proper technique, and intensity-to show followers of the program solid results, beginning in as little as four weeks if they stick with the clearly written, easy-to-implement, fitness and nutritional guidelines contained herein. The first part of this book lays the groundwork for success in attaining health and fitness goals. It contains advice, information, and inspiration, and is peppered throughout with useful, motivating anecdotes drawn from the author's life as an exercise physiologist, inspirational speaker, and trainer. The second part deals with practical training methods, offering program options for beginning, intermediate, and advanced levels of fitness. It provides a full menu of exercises for each major muscle group, with a focus on strength training, which is one of the most direct ways of attaining and maintaining a youthful existence. The exercises are accompanied by detailed instructions and photographs to help readers visualize the routines. An extensive glossary, resources list, and reference section are included. Book jacket.

Ageless by Andrew Steele Pdf

“A fascinating look at how scientists are working to help doctors treat the aging process itself, helping us all to lead longer, healthier lives.” —Sanjay Gupta, MD Aging—not cancer, not heart disease—is the underlying cause of most human death and suffering. The same cascade of biological changes that renders us wrinkled and gray also opens the door to dementia and disease. We work furiously to conquer each individual disease, but we never think to ask: Is aging itself necessary? Nature tells us it is not: there are tortoises and salamanders who are spry into old age and whose risk of dying is the same no matter how old they are, a phenomenon known as “biological immortality.” In Ageless, Andrew Steelecharts the astounding progress science has made in recent years to secure the same for humans: to help us become old without getting frail, to live longer without ill health or disease.

Stopping the Clock by Ronald Klatz,Robert Goldman, M.D. Pdf

Why many of us will live past 100--and enjoy our extra years. In Stopping the Clock, two pioneers of anti-aging medicine show how we can start now to regain energy and vitality, halt or reverse damage to our bodies, and avoid the diseases--heart attack, arthritis, cancer, diabetes--that do most to reduce current life expectancy. In sixteen fully-documented, information-packed chapters, Klatz and Goldman detail an up-to-the-minute longevity program, including: The key anti-aging hormones: Melatonin, DHEA, and human growth hormone, how to take them and precautions to use. The sex hormones: the role of estrogen and progesterone supplementation, including natural alternatives to prescription hormones--plus new research on testosterone supplementation for men and women. The role of the "miracle minerals"--chromium, selenium and magnesium--and the latest information on the key anti-oxidant vitamins and how to take them. A thyroid support program to avoid the many dangerous effects of thyroid deficiency. A sensible approach to anti-aging exercise--plus 25 ways to defeat the aging effects of stress. The life-long diet--including the top 25 healing foods. A longevity test to determine your current estimated lifespan. Personal longevity programs--including daily supplement regiments--from 28 leaders of anti-aging medicine. Glossary of 75 anti-aging substances available at health-food stores.

Aging Backwards by Miranda Esmonde-White Pdf

A ground-breaking guide to understanding how aging happens in our cells and how to maintain and repair those cells--and roll back joint pain and muscle loss at any age--through gentle, scientifically designed workouts based on Classical Stretch and Essentrics, developed by the author and star of PBS's Classical Stretch series. It's never too late to slow down, or even reverse, the effects of aging. The human body is designed to function for the full length of its life--and with gentle, full-body flexibility and strengthening exercises we can look and feel tremendous, vibrant and active at any age, and well into our senior years. After all, the body is the world's most efficient self-healing machine. And yet, remarkably, many of us neglect the single most important system in the body--the one that makes all the others work--the muscular system. The typical message we get as we age is that we can move less and should take it easy--exactly the wrong advice. Surprisingly, fitness enthusiasts often do as much harm to their bodies as people living sedentary lives. For example, yoga instructors get tennis elbow or carpal tunnel syndrome from daily stress on wrists and elbows; Pilates instructors suffer pectoral and tricep muscle atrophy and even professional athletes grow overweight and suffer countless ACL, meniscus and disc injuries. Ligaments are virtually ignored by most exercises routines and yet joint health is essential in order to remain active. But these afflictions don't happen overnight, and with Aging Backwards we can slow or prevent their onset, and often reverse their symptoms.
